The US Defense Intelligence Agency (DIA) has awarded a task order to General Dynamics (GD) Information Technology to provide information assurance and cybersecurity services.

The task order was awarded under the solutions for the information technology enterprise (SITE) contract and will extend to May 2016, if all options are exercised.

Under the $86m contract, GD will provide services to ensure the security, authenticity, integrity and confidentiality of DIA’s information.

The services will also support computer network defence of the DIA’s global enterprise-level assets, networks, security domains and data resources.

Work will be performed at US Department of Defense (DoD) combatant commands worldwide and in the Washington DC, US.
